| 摘要: |
| 计算性能和合成性能对于基于工作站网的软件十分重要,但由于缺乏相应的开发环境,现在这类软件在这两方面还做得很不够,尤其是合成性能十分薄弱.该文提出并实现了一种基于分布对象的并行程序设计框架,力图使分布对象能提供高性能的并行计算服务,同时也使并行算法获得一种良好的封装和复用机制.经过一些并行算法的测试,表明该框架具有实用价值. |
| 关键词: 分布对象,并行程序设计,工作站网,框架. |

| A Distributed Object Based Framework for Parallel Programming |

| Abstract: |
| The computational and compositional features are very important in the construction of software for the workstation clusters. However, due to the lack of suitable supporting environment of software development, most existing distributed parallel software systems are weak in these two aspects, especially in the compositional feature. In this paper, a distributed object based framework for parallel programming is proposed. The goals of the framework are: first, getting high parallel computing efficiency; second, constructing a mechanism to encapsulate and reuse parallel program. The framework is tested by some parallel algorithms, the results indicate that the framework is helpful. |
| Key words: Distributed object, parallel programming, workstation clusters, framework. |
